Mississinewa won the last time they faced Blackford and things went their way on Saturday too. The Indians blew past the Bruins 9-4. Mississinewa might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won four matchups by four goals or more this season.
They hit Blackford with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Seth Yoder (4), Bryson Vasquez (4), and Hayden Bull.
The win got Mississinewa back to even at 5-5-1. As for Blackford, their loss dropped their record down to 3-8-1.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Mississinewa will take on Tippecanoe Valley at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. Mississinewa will be up against Tippecanoe Valley's rather soft defense (which has allowed 6.42 goals per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. As for Blackford, they will square off against Wapahani at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
